基于DMEA的航空地面电源车战场损伤研究

摘    要:装备的战场损伤研究是装备维修以及性能改进的重要内容。文中主要介绍了战场损伤研究方法中的损坏模式及影响分析方法,并将此方法应用于航空地面电源车的战场损伤研究,提出了其战场损伤的主要模式及影响分析,并根据损伤模式提出了相应的抢修方案,为其战场抢修工作提供了一定的指导。

关 键 词:损坏模式及影响分析  航空地面电源车  战场损伤

Battlefield Damage Research of Aerial Power Supply Vehicle Based on DMEA

Abstract:The battlefield damage research of equipment is the important content of equipment service and performance improvement. Damage mode and effects analysis in battlefield damage research method was introduced. The analysis method was applied in battlefield damage research of aerial power supply vehicle. The mode and effects of the aerial power supply vehicle were analyzed and the corresponding maintaining method was put forward. The purpose was to provide guidance for battlefield repair.
